On Sat, Mar 21, 2009 at 4:28 PM, Grant Likely <grant.lik...@secretlab.ca> wrote: > From: Grant Likely <grant.lik...@secretlab.ca> > > This patch makes changes in preparation for supporting open firmware > device tree descriptions of MDIO busses. Changes include: > - Cleanup handling of phy_map[] entries; they are already NULLed when > registering and so don't need to be re-cleared, and it is good practice > to clear them out when unregistering. > - Split phy_device registration out into a new function so that the > OF helpers can do two stage registration (separate allocation and > registration steps). > > Signed-off-by: Grant Likely <grant.lik...@secretlab.ca> > CC: linuxppc-dev@ozlabs.org > CC: net...@vger.kernel.org > CC: Andy Fleming <aflem...@freescale.com> > --- > > drivers/net/phy/mdio_bus.c | 29 +++------------------------ > drivers/net/phy/phy_device.c | 45 > ++++++++++++++++++++++++++++++++++++++---- > include/linux/phy.h | 1 + > 3 files changed, 45 insertions(+), 30 deletions(-) > > > diff --git a/drivers/net/phy/mdio_bus.c b/drivers/net/phy/mdio_bus.c > index 811a637..3c39c7b 100644 > --- a/drivers/net/phy/mdio_bus.c > +++ b/drivers/net/phy/mdio_bus.c > @@ -112,7 +112,6 @@ int mdiobus_register(struct mii_bus *bus) > bus->reset(bus); > > for (i = 0; i < PHY_MAX_ADDR; i++) { > - bus->phy_map[i] = NULL; > if ((bus->phy_mask & (1 << i)) == 0) { > struct phy_device *phydev; > > @@ -149,6 +148,7 @@ void mdiobus_unregister(struct mii_bus *bus) > for (i = 0; i < PHY_MAX_ADDR; i++) { > if (bus->phy_map[i]) > device_unregister(&bus->phy_map[i]->dev); > + bus->phy_map[i] = NULL; > } > } > EXPORT_SYMBOL(mdiobus_unregister); > @@ -187,35 +187,12 @@ struct phy_device *mdiobus_scan(struct mii_bus *bus, > int addr) > if (IS_ERR(phydev) || phydev == NULL) > return phydev; > > - /* There's a PHY at this address > - * We need to set: > - * 1) IRQ > - * 2) bus_id > - * 3) parent > - * 4) bus > - * 5) mii_bus > - * And, we need to register it */ > - > - phydev->irq = bus->irq != NULL ?
